PHRC Port Harcourt Refinery is a refinery in Nigeria. Its listed capacity is 210,000 BBL per day. Refineries heat, fractionate and chemically transform crude oil into fuels and petrochemical feedstocks through energy-intensive distillation and cracking — extremely demanding on steam generation and heat recovery. It is operated by NNPC Ltd. By capacity it ranks #2 among 9 oil refineries in Nigeria. It emits about 185,439 t CO₂e a year from Climate TRACE. That is 0.56% of the CO₂e from the 25 facilities in Nigeria that have an emissions figure in IndustryAtlas. Its CO₂ per unit of capacity is 90% below the national median for this sector.

Capacity and operating-status verification
210,000 bpd two-refinery complex design capacity; not in stable commercial operation, with completion and restart work proposed in 2026
Checked 2026-07-19. Capacity is the cited nameplate, design or commissioned processing capacity, not actual daily throughput. Status is stated separately and reflects the latest source checked; planned expansions are excluded until commissioned. Site climate & environmental severity
This site sits in a corrosive environment (estimated ISO 9223 class C4 — High), with humidity / wetness the leading environmental stress.
In this site’s local climate, a bare 150 °C surface sheds about 1236 W/m² to ambient — roughly 0.95× the loss at a 20 °C reference.
